This is for today's sketch challenge. I've cut out my images from a DP stack by Amanda Blu, cut out and popped up the big butterfly twice. The tulip I colorized with markers and a watercolor brush. The card base is Whisper White, then a panel of gray textured Bazzill, then the DP; all layers popped up for dimension. I've used a black cloth brad, with a green rhinestone on top of it on the sentiment panel, which reads, *One touch of nature makes the whole world kin* (William Shakespeare) I thought it was very appropriate for my card today.
Inside I stamped the fern, stamped off twice to make it very light, then overstamped the butterfly.
